Extremely fast delivery and easy shopping experience. Hamper was a gift and she loved it.
Love Matcha green tea in the morning’s real refreshing and then again after lunch will keep buying
Your iodine at a safe, but strong level 1 drop a day keeps the doctor away. Well it will definitely give you 150ug of iodine. That's 100% of your NRV.
Your iodine at a safe, but strong level 1 drop a day keeps the doctor away. Well it will definitely give you 150ug of iodine. That's 100% of your NRV.